The amount of candy that would be in each jar would be 0.79 lbs.
In order to determine the amount of candy each jar will contain, the total number of candy would be divided by the number of jars available. This means that 7.11 lbs of candy would be divided by 9. This means that each jar would contain the same amount of candy.
Amount each jar would contain = total amount of candy / total number of jars
7.11 lbs / 9 = 0.79 lbs
